Output 83ed73032951898bb860f17d84b4583a5309e601414c92871be604d8e10c7bfa:1

value
7118628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ae73c68af80483b7669cfaba54a24c21e90a667a OP_EQUAL
address
MPoaW31bKnV9JMzqt5EdWQcQ9AZDdMxEsS
transaction
83ed73032951898bb860f17d84b4583a5309e601414c92871be604d8e10c7bfa
spent
true